0:52 to become who you are once again it is
0:53 called the hero because it has the
0:56 energy of a hero a heroic kind of energy
0:58 the hero of each of the 16 types is
1:00 powerful and capable our most natural
1:03 skill lies in whatever function our hero
1:05 is expressed through the hero is the
1:06 first of the eight cognitive attitudes
1:09 and reveals our most constant need while
1:11 other functions like the parent inferior
1:13 or Nemesis might need a smaller dose of
1:16 whatever they seek the hero needs it a
1:18 lot and it needs it often ni Heroes for
1:21 example need a lot of freedom constantly
1:22 te Heroes need a lot of status and
1:25 information constantly SI Heroes need to
1:28 feel safe and strong constantly this
1:30 constant aspect of the hero makes it
1:32 incredibly needy however just like a
1:33 bodybuilder consumes thousands of
1:36 calories a day to perform the hero will
1:38 perform to its fullest if its needs are
1:40 being met but what is a cognitive
1:42 attitude here lies the vital distinction
1:44 between a cognitive attitude and a
1:46 cognitive function every type has all
1:48 eight cognitive attitudes like the hero
1:50 parent and child and all eight cognitive
1:52 functions like introverted thinking and
1:54 extroverted sensing but each function
1:56 throughout the 16 types is expressed
1:58 differently depending on which attitude
1:59 it is in one way to think of an attit
2:01 attitude is like a slot that a given
2:03 function is expressed through for
2:05 example the hero is optimistic and has a
2:08 natural can do energy the parent however
2:10 is more pessimistic and responsible
2:12 looking for ways that things could go
2:14 wrong when extroverted Intuition or NE
2:16 is in the hero as is the case for the
2:19 entp and the ENFP they use NE
2:21 optimistically where they are
2:22 enthusiastic about the options and
2:24 possibilities available to others but
2:28 any parent as is the case for inps and
2:30 infps they're cautious about
2:32 possibilities and opportunities any
2:34 parent wants to know how things could go
2:36 wrong while any hero is more focused on
2:37 how things could go right ultimately
2:39 there are eight expressions of each
2:41 function extroverted intuition is
2:43 expressed in eight different ways like
2:46 any child any Nemesis any critic Etc
2:47 meaning that understanding the cognitive
2:50 function itself is not enough we need to
2:51 understand the different ways how a
2:53 function is used experienced and
2:55 expressed through all the 16 types the
2:58 eight hero functions te hero entjs and
3:00 estjs are all about understanding
3:02 beliefs and Gathering knowledge te
3:04 heroes are aware of what others think
3:05 like all extroverted functions
3:07 extroverted thinking hero is heroic
3:09 about Gathering and organizing
3:11 information they're also excellent at
3:12 forming and upholding standards and
3:14 procedures being aware of how others
3:17 think entjs and esjs pursue symbols of
3:19 achievement to gain status they want to
3:21 be regarded or thought of Highly by
3:24 other people TI hero inps and istps are
3:26 keenly aware of what they think TI
3:28 heroes are super fast and accurate
3:30 processors of information if a person
3:32 tells them their opinion the INTP and
3:34 istp are able to dig into that bit of
3:36 information faster than any of the types
3:38 and test an argument for its strength
3:40 and accuracy they sniff out in
3:42 consistencies faster than anyone else
3:44 intps and istps lead with their
3:46 awareness of logical consistency problem
3:48 solving and filtering through their mind
3:51 first asking a TI hero what they think
3:53 will help them respect you quickly Fe
3:56 hero enfjs and esfjs are Naturals at
3:58 healing others pain and lifting them up
4:00 extroverted feeling the function that
4:02 governs empathy compassion and ethical
4:04 awareness makes enfjs and esfjs
4:06 naturally selfless and caring of those
4:08 around them the ENFJ and ESFJ are
4:10 extremely aware of the emotional states
4:12 of others they have a knack for sensing
4:13 when someone is off and helping that
4:15 person walk through their pain to get
4:17 back on track these two types also
4:19 enforce social norms expecting others to
4:21 follow the rules of a family group or
4:25 Society fi hero infps and isfps wear
4:26 their hearts on their sleeves and if
4:29 they don't they desperately want to fi
4:31 hero is sharpened awareness of One's Own
4:33 emotions values and moods infps and
4:36 isfps have a strong sense of what they
4:37 value they don't care much about what
4:40 others value in fact they're naturally
4:42 skeptical of others worth fi hero makes
4:45 infps and isfps also naturally
4:47 expressive fi is one of the strongest
4:48 functions when it comes to motivating
4:51 personal expression whether it be art
4:53 Sports craftsmanship philosophy or
4:55 academics infps and isfps want to make
4:57 their values emotions and moral
4:59 philosophies compelling in all they do
5:02 any hero entps and enfps live in the
5:04 realm of possibilities they see the
5:06 world the opportunities in their daily
5:08 life relationships and others Pursuits
5:10 through the lens of possibility
5:12 everything to the entp and ENFP is about
5:14 potential part of potential however is
5:17 an awareness of consequences entps and
5:19 enfps are the Watchers for avoiding bad
5:22 outcomes but they can also steer others
5:23 toward Prosperity they see the
5:25 consequences of an action before anyone
5:27 else does and they love to set others up
5:29 for a better future but while they are
5:31 natur at helping others Futures they
5:32 struggle with helping their own the
5:35 other aspect of any hero is desirability
5:37 both the ntps and enfps instinctively
5:40 know how to Garner desire from others
5:41 they want to be wanted and go out of
5:43 their way to make themselves as
5:46 desirable as possible an i hero injs and
5:48 INFJs are always thinking about
5:50 possibilities for their own Futures
5:51 while any heroes are aware of
5:53 possibilities for others and I heroes
5:55 are aware of possibilities for
5:57 themselves injs and INFJs are among the
5:59 most Wy of all the types constantly
6:01 searching for the future path they want
6:03 most and considering the steps of how to
6:05 realize that path but ni heroes are
6:08 often extremely willful and often
6:09 obstinate when they're invested in
6:11 pursuing a path they can be very
6:14 difficult to derail or deter but they
6:16 often pursue their path with such Vigor
6:17 that they burn out and when they burn
6:19 out they can become like impotent rag
6:22 dolls this oscillation between being a
6:24 fiery force to be reckoned with and
6:26 being a rag doll is something that the
6:28 inj and infj have to balance in their
6:30 lives they will burn out if they don't
6:32 properly manage the desire of their an
6:35 injs and INFJs will form detailed
6:36 pictures of their path in their mind
6:38 even if they don't know what they want
6:40 they're always searching for It
6:42 ultimately injs and INFJs are looking
6:43 for freedom and are seeking the Liberty
6:45 to create their own path without their
6:48 ni being imposed upon SE hero estps and
6:50 esfps are seeking to deliver the
6:52 Ultimate Experience to those around them
6:54 they are aware of the Comfort level and
6:56 attentiveness of others estps and esfps
6:58 want to command attention from others
6:59 they tend to make other people people
7:01 around them comfortable and at ease but
7:03 SE heroes are also aware of the strength
7:05 and skill of those around them they want
7:06 to build up the strength and competence
7:08 of others so that the people in their
7:10 lives become more capable and more loyal
7:12 ultimately estps and esfps are looking
7:15 for people who will stick around SI hero
7:18 istjs and isfjs are seeking safety
7:20 comfort and strength SI heroes are Duty
7:22 based types motivated by fulfilling the
7:25 role that their Duty requires the istj
7:27 and the isfj are among the most reliable
7:29 of all the types their SI hero makes
7:32 them consistent disciplined and risk
7:34 averse the biggest need for istjs and
7:37 isfjs is good experiences they want to
7:39 gather up good experiences through the
7:40 five senses of their introverted sensing
7:42 awareness the concept of Creature
7:44 Comforts is very important to all the SI
7:47 users but especially the SI Heroes they
7:48 reward themselves for their hard work by
7:50 indulging in activities or food or drink
7:53 that they enjoy the two sides of Si hero
7:57 are one work and then two enjoy SI
7:58 heroes are seeking others who will
8:00 respect their boundaries of safety and
8:02 comfort but it's not just about the
8:04 internal experience of bliss istjs and
8:07 isfjs also want to be strong and they
8:08 engage in habits and activities that
8:10 will increase their strength ultimately
8:12 they want to be strong for other people
8:14 the limitations of the hero the hero is
8:16 our most powerful function but it is not
8:18 without its flaws the biggest flaw of
8:20 the hero emerges when we assume our hero
8:22 can do everything to a hammer everything
8:25 looks like a nail and to Our Heroes ever
8:27 optimistic and confident everything
8:28 seems simple and straightforward when
8:31 any obstacle arises our hero naturally
8:33 reacts I can do that but this is far
8:35 from the case the path of the hero to
8:37 True greatness lies in each of the 16
8:39 types recognizing how their hero is
8:41 limited and that maturity responsibility
8:43 and courage are required for each of our
8:46 toolkits to be expanded yes the hero may
8:48 be each of our hammers but we have all
8:49 of the eight cognitive functions within
8:51 us and unless we seek to develop the
8:54 other seven tools in our psyche the hero
8:56 though powerful will remain immature and
8:58 not very capable this series on the
